INTRODUCTION
Join Cleveland Clinic’s Mercy Hospital where research and surgery are advanced, technology is leading-edge, patient care is world-class, and caregivers are family. Officially becoming a full member of the Cleveland Clinic Health System in 2021, Mercy Hospital offers 476 beds and a wide variety of medical specialties to the communities in and around Stark County. Here, you will work alongside passionate and dedicated caregivers, receive endless support and appreciation, and build a rewarding career with one of the most respected healthcare organizations in the world.
Mercy Hospital’s 5B Orthopaedic Unit cares for planned orthopaedic post-op surgical patients (hip and knee replacements, spine, and neck surgeries), orthopaedic injuries (falls and car accidents), and trauma patients that don’t require critical care or are ready to come out of the ICU (gunshots, wounds, stabbings, car accidents, and traumatic falls). This collaborative unit works with Orthopaedic Surgeons, Nurse Practitioners, Physician Assistants, Physical Therapists, Occupational Therapists, and the trauma team. 5B is known for their community outreach for various donation drives throughout the year and their phenomenal caregiver retention, as there are a lot of experienced caregivers who have been here for 8+ years.
As a Patient Care Nurse Assistant (PCNA) on the team, you will coordinate with fellow caregivers to create a welcoming, healing and warm environment for patients in the unit. This position offers the ability to pursue educational advancement, higher positions and skills development courses offered by Cleveland Clinic. In this role, you have an excellent opportunity to start your nursing career and work in a supportive and caring healthcare setting.
A caregiver in this position works days from 7:00AM – 7:30PM, including rotating weekends and holidays.
A caregiver who excels in this role will:
- Provide or assist with patient care under the supervision of an RN. Patient care may include vital signs, weight, assisting patients with personal care and activities of daily living, patient transfers/transport, pulse oximetry, point of care testing, dressing changes, applying external monitoring devices and removing urinary Foley catheter.
- Report abnormal findings or changes in physical, mental and emotional conditions to an RN.
- Assist with keeping patients’ rooms clean and orderly.
MINIMUM QUALIFICATIONS
- High School Diploma or GED
- Basic Life Support (BLS) certification through the American Heart Association (AHA) or American Red Cross (If you do not hold this certification, you must obtain it during your new hire period)
- Nursing students: Basic Life Support (BLS) certification through the American Heart Association (AHA) or American Red Cross upon hire
- Military experience as a Hospital Corpsman (HM), Combat Medic (68W) or Medical Service Technician (4N0X1) will be considered
PREFERRED QUALIFICATIONS
- State Tested Nursing Assistant (STNA)
Physical Requirements
Requires full body motion to move and lift patients, manual finger dexterity with good eye-hand coordination; involves extensive standing and walking.
Medium Work - Exerting 20 to 50 pounds of force occasionally, and/or 10 to 25 pounds of force frequently, and/or greater than negligible up to 10 pounds of force constantly to move objects.
Physical Demand requirements are in excess of those for Light Work.
PERSONAL PROTECTIVE EQUIPMENT
Follows standard precautions using personal protective equipment as required.
PAY RANGE
- Minimum hourly: $18.25
- Maximum hourly: $24.95
The pay range displayed on this job posting reflects the anticipated range for new hires. A successful candidate’s actual compensation will be determined after taking factors into consideration such as the candidate’s work history, experience, skill set and education. The pay range displayed does not include any applicable pay practices (e.g., shift differentials, overtime, etc.). The pay range does not include the value of Cleveland Clinic’s benefits package (e.g., healthcare, dental and vision benefits, retirement savings account contributions, etc.).

Align your credentials to specialty occupation standards
Cleveland Clinic's H-1B roles in medicine, research, and clinical care require a direct connection between your degree field and the position. Pull the occupation's O*NET profile and confirm your credentials map to the specific specialty before applying.
Target departments with recurring international hiring
Cleveland Clinic's research institutes, cardiovascular programs, and graduate medical education departments have historically brought on international candidates. Filter your job search by these divisions rather than applying broadly across the entire health system.
Verify Cleveland Clinic's E-Verify enrollment before accepting
As a STEM OPT employer, Cleveland Clinic must be enrolled in E-Verify. Confirm this before signing any offer letter. If you're transitioning from OPT to H-1B, this enrollment is a prerequisite for your cap-gap authorization to remain valid.
Benchmark your salary against prevailing wage data
Before negotiating your offer, check the OFLC Wage Search for your occupation code and Cleveland Clinic's Ohio or Florida location. Your offered wage must meet the DOL prevailing wage for your role, and knowing the floor strengthens your negotiating position.

Clarify H-1B petition timing during your offer negotiation
Cleveland Clinic's HR and legal teams handle H-1B filings internally, but processing timelines vary by department and time of year. Ask your recruiter whether they plan to file under standard or premium USCIS processing so you can plan your start date accurately.
Cleveland Clinic H-1B Visa Sponsorship: Frequently Asked Questions
Does Cleveland Clinic sponsor H-1B visas?
Yes, Cleveland Clinic sponsors H-1B visas across clinical, research, and administrative roles. The organization has an established immigration program that handles petitions internally. Sponsorship is most common for physicians, nurses, research scientists, and allied health professionals where the role meets the USCIS specialty occupation standard.
Which roles and departments at Cleveland Clinic typically receive H-1B sponsorship?
H-1B sponsorship at Cleveland Clinic is concentrated in clinical medicine, biomedical research, nursing, pharmacy, and health informatics. Graduate medical education positions and research institute roles are particularly active. Roles that require a specific bachelor's degree or higher in a directly related field are the strongest candidates for H-1B approval under USCIS guidelines.
How do I navigate the H-1B application process at Cleveland Clinic?
Once Cleveland Clinic extends a job offer, their internal immigration or HR team initiates the H-1B process, which begins with a Labor Condition Application filed with the DOL. How do I estimate the H-1B timeline if I'm applying to Cleveland Clinic?
The H-1B cap runs on a federal fiscal year cycle, with petitions filed in April for an October 1 start date. If Cleveland Clinic files under standard USCIS processing, expect several months of wait time after the lottery selection. Premium processing shortens the adjudication window to roughly 15 business days, though employer participation varies.
What practical steps should I take before applying to Cleveland Clinic for an H-1B role?
Confirm your degree field maps directly to the role's O*NET occupation profile, check the OFLC Wage Search to understand the prevailing wage for your position and location, and verify Cleveland Clinic's E-Verify enrollment. Ask your recruiter early whether H-1B sponsorship is available for the specific role, as sponsorship decisions can vary by department and budget cycle.
What is the prevailing wage for H-1B jobs at Cleveland Clinic?
H-1B employers must pay at least the prevailing wage, which is determined when they file the Labor Condition Application with the Department of Labor. The rate is based on the role, location, and experience level, and ensures international hires are paid comparably to U.S. workers in the same position. You can look up prevailing wage rates for any occupation and location using the DOL's OFLC Wage Search tool.
